
Sun Mar 30 19:30:00 UTC 2025: ## Napoli Edges Out Milan in Thrilling 2-1 Victory
**Naples, Italy** – A thrilling encounter at the Stadio Diego Armando Maradona saw Napoli narrowly defeat AC Milan 2-1, maintaining their pursuit of league leaders Inter Milan. The match, filled with late drama and controversial moments, saw Napoli take an early lead and hold on despite a late Milan push.
Napoli dominated the first half, scoring twice in quick succession. A precise strike from Matteo Politano opened the scoring after just 63 seconds, capitalizing on defensive errors from Hernandez and Pavlovic. Shortly after, Romelu Lukaku doubled the lead with a scrappy finish, assisted by Gilmour. Milan offered little in response, with their defensive frailties again exposed.
The second half witnessed a more determined Milan side, who introduced several substitutes, injecting fresh impetus into their attack. They pulled one goal back through a Jovic header, sparking a tense final period. Milan pressed for an equalizer in the dying moments, even hitting the post, but Napoli held firm to secure the crucial three points. A late red card for Milan’s Diaz added to the drama.
The victory keeps Napoli within striking distance of Inter, while Milan’s hopes of Champions League qualification, and even Europa League contention, appear increasingly slim. The match also saw several bookings for both managers, reflecting the intense nature of the clash.
